Beware of models that are too small to meet your storage needs or those that sacrifice quality for a lower price.Size and Capacity
Size and capacity are the most apparent considerations. You need a freezer that fits comfortably in your apartment without crowding your living space, yet offers enough room to store your essentials. Chest freezers tend to maximize storage in a smaller footprint, but upright models can be more accessible. Think about your typical storage volume and choose a model that offers a bit more room to allow for flexibility and future needs. Overly small freezers may force frequent defrosting or limit your freezing options.
Energy Efficiency
Energy efficiency can significantly impact your utility bills over time. Look for freezers with good seals, proper insulation, and energy-saving features like LED lighting or efficient compressors. Cheaper models might save money upfront but could consume more power, increasing your costs. Choosing an ENERGY STAR-certified model often balances efficiency and performance, ensuring your small freezer doesn’t become a hidden expense.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much space do I need for a compact freezer in my apartment?
Most compact freezers designed for apartments require about 2 to 4 cubic feet of space. Measure your available area carefully, including clearance for door opening and ventilation. Chest freezers tend to be wider but lower, fitting better in some spaces, while upright models are taller and narrower. Always account for some extra room around the unit for airflow and maintenance access.
Are upright or chest freezers better for small apartments?
Upright freezers are generally easier to access and organize with shelves and door compartments, making them suitable for quick retrieval of items. Chest freezers, on the other hand, often provide more storage capacity for the same footprint and are more energy-efficient. The choice depends on your space layout and personal preference—if space is tight, a chest model might maximize storage, but if ease of use is a priority, an upright could be better.
How important is energy efficiency in small freezers?
Energy efficiency becomes more relevant in small freezers because they run constantly, and even small differences in power consumption can add up over time. An ENERGY STAR-rated model typically consumes less electricity, saving you money on utility bills. This is especially true if you plan to run the freezer continuously or have limited ventilation in your apartment. Choosing an efficient model can also lessen environmental impact.
